Output 26580c91a72e3954d6760d4ea2847a9d94d6848c1a58cefecd93c11bc561192e:0

value
235450668
script pubkey
OP_0 OP_PUSHBYTES_20 6de266063d72f113a88de9debfb457f762fa4e0d
address
bc1qdh3xvp3awtc382yda80tldzh7a305nsd88axhg
transaction
26580c91a72e3954d6760d4ea2847a9d94d6848c1a58cefecd93c11bc561192e